diff --git a/arch/arm64/boot/dts/amlogic/gxl_p212_1g.dts b/arch/arm64/boot/dts/amlogic/gxl_p212_1g.dts index e219ad0e3814..4eefc12a7c88 100644 --- a/arch/arm64/boot/dts/amlogic/gxl_p212_1g.dts +++ b/arch/arm64/boot/dts/amlogic/gxl_p212_1g.dts @@ -88,7 +88,7 @@ ion_reserved:linux,ion-dev { compatible = "shared-dma-pool"; reusable; - size = <0x0 0x7C00000>; + size = <0x0 0x4C00000>; alignment = <0x0 0x400000>; }; @@ -119,7 +119,7 @@ compatible = "shared-dma-pool"; reusable; /* ion_codec_mm max can alloc size 80M*/ - size = <0x0 0x13400000>; + size = <0x0 0xd000000>; alignment = <0x0 0x400000>; linux,contiguous-region; }; diff --git a/drivers/amlogic/media/common/codec_mm/codec_mm.c b/drivers/amlogic/media/common/codec_mm/codec_mm.c index 7bc3321455f4..da7591c4c163 100644 --- a/drivers/amlogic/media/common/codec_mm/codec_mm.c +++ b/drivers/amlogic/media/common/codec_mm/codec_mm.c @@ -56,7 +56,7 @@ #define MM_ALIGN_UP2N(addr, alg2n) ((addr+(1<